CVE-2023-23412: Windows Accounts Picture Elevation of Privilege Vulnerability

What privileges could be gained by an attacker who successfully exploited the vulnerability?

An attacker would only be able to delete targeted files on a system. They would not gain privileges to view or modify file contents.
